Vulcan
General Information
The hex color #0E1326, often referred to as "Vulcan," is a deep, dark shade of blue-black. It belongs to the family of near-black colors, offering a sophisticated and understated appearance. In the RGB color model, it is composed of 5.5% red, 7.5% green, and 14.9% blue. This composition results in a color that is perceived as serious, professional, and modern. Vulcan can evoke feelings of mystery and sophistication, making it a popular choice for backgrounds and design elements that require a touch of elegance. Its low saturation ensures it remains subtle, allowing other colors in a design to stand out without competition. The hex color #0e1326, also known as Vulcan, presents specific accessibility challenges due to its dark nature. When used as a background color, it necessitates very light text to ensure sufficient contrast for readability. According to WCAG guidelines, the contrast ratio between the text and background should be at least 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text. Using tools like contrast checkers is crucial to verify compliance. Designers and developers must carefully select foreground colors to meet these standards, considering users with visual impairments who rely on high contrast to perceive content effectively. Insufficient contrast can lead to a poor user experience and exclusion of users with disabilities. Therefore, consider lighter shades or alternative color combinations to enhance accessibility.

Web Design
In web design, #0E1326 can serve as a sophisticated background for portfolios or tech-related websites. Its dark and muted tone projects an aura of professionalism and modernity. However, careful consideration must be given to text color; opting for shades of white or light grays to guarantee readability and comply with accessibility standards. For instance, pairing it with #FFFFFF or #F0F0F0 ensures the content remains both aesthetically pleasing and user-friendly. Additionally, the color can be effectively used in website headers or footers to create a visually appealing contrast with lighter content areas.
